OR...Is something not right about naming a 3D horror movie--whose commercial features a wall of flames bursting from a movie screen towards it's 3D-glass-wearing audience--after a highly influential indie-rock band? (left: Alas there is a "3D" to make a distinction between the two.) CORRECTION: It didn't occur to me until my friend Randy corrected me today that My Bloody Valentine, the highly influential indie-rock band, actually got their name from the 1981 slasher movie, My Bloody Valentine.
